Paulson Nebula

The Paulson Nebula in 2366

The Paulson Nebula was a nebula located in Federation space near the trade route between Zeta Alpha II and Sentinel Minor IV. The nebula contained swirling dust clouds, large rocks, and clumpy material which presented a navigational hazard for starships.

In 2256, this nebula's location in the Beta Quadrant was labeled on the star chart "Alpha/Beta Quadrant Overview" in the ready room aboard the USS Discovery. (DIS: "Magic to Make the Sanest Man Go Mad") Later, in 2257, its location was also labeled on a tactical star chart of "803.16 80 10 Nav Lat Position." (DIS: "What's Past Is Prologue")

In 2259, the location of this nebula was labeled on a stellar cartography chart that was seen on the USS Enterprise's ready room viewscreen. (SNW: "Strange New Worlds", "Spock Amok")

In 2366, the USS Enterprise-D used it to hide from a pursuing Borg cube. The Enterprise had to slow to impulse to enter it. Once inside, the nebula became too dense to go farther using impulse. The composition of the nebula cloud was determined to be 82% dilithium hydroxyls, magnesium, and chromium and found to be effective in screening the Enterprise from the sensors of the Borg, so the Enterprise continued on into this denser spiral cloud section of the nebula. The Borg did not follow them in but continued to scan for them and adapt to the situation. Eventually, the Borg started sending in magnetometric guided charges and the Enterprise was forced to leave the nebula. (TNG: "The Best of Both Worlds")

In the episode's script, the Paulson Nebula was identified as a solar nebula.
Visuals of the Paulson Nebula are a modified version of the Mutara Nebula visuals from Star Trek II: The Wrath of Khan.
In the episode's final draft script the nebula contained manganese instead of magnesium.
